Indian rupee have declined 10 percent, 3 percent and 7.2 percent, respectively, against the U.S. dollar since Fed Chairman Ben Bernanke started talking about tapering on May 22. These currencies have been vulnerable to heavy selling given worries about their large current account deficits.

The rupee dropped to a record low in early trade on Monday tracking gains in the U.S. dollar after disappointing data from China and slightly better-than-expected US jobs data.
The partially convertible rupee was trading at 57.37/38 per dollar after hitting a record low of 57.38, past the...

The rupee fell to its lowest in more than a week in late trade on Friday on suspected heavy dollar buying by a large state-run bank that several dealers said appeared to be on behalf of defense-related state-run companies.
